The situation when the refrigerator Stinol freezer continues to freeze food properly, and in the main chamber the temperature rises to room temperature, is a classic symptom for two-compressor and some single-compressor models of this brand. The owner is faced with spoiled food in the upper compartment, while everything below turns to ice. Such a stratification of the temperature regime indicates that the cooling system has not completely failed, but the cold circulation is disrupted precisely in the refrigeration compartment circuit.
Most often, the problem lies not in a complete loss of system tightness, but in a local electronics failure, a clogged capillary tube, or a malfunction of the defrost system. Brand units Stinol, especially models of the 102, 103 and 104 series, have their own design features that must be taken into account when troubleshooting. Understanding the operating principle of your specific device is the first step to successfully restoring functionality without calling a technician.
The further algorithm of actions depends on how many compressors are installed in your refrigerator. If there are two of them, then a breakdown of one of them or its control circuit will leave the second camera in working condition. If there is only one compressor, then the reason almost certainly lies in the cold distribution system or in the control unit, which has stopped sending a signal to turn on the fan or defrost heating element.
Diagnostics of two-compressor Stinol models
In models with two compressors, each cooling circuit operates independently. This means that if the freezer freezes, it means that one compressor, its start relay and thermostat are working. The problem is localized exclusively in the circuit responsible for the refrigeration compartment. First of all, you need to listen to the operation of the unit: is the second motor-compressor working at all?
If the motor is humming, but there is no cold, there may be a freon leak in the refrigeration chamber circuit or the thermostat has failed. In models Stinol-102 and Stinol-104 thermostats often fail due to power surges. They simply stop closing the contacts, and the compressor does not receive a command to start, although there is electricity in the outlet.
⚠️ Attention: When diagnosing two-compressor models, do not try to replace the thermostat from the freezer to the refrigerator - they have different temperature response ranges, which will lead to food spoilage or freezing of the evaporator.
It is important to check the starting relay. If the compressor hums for several seconds, clicks and turns off, the relay or the motor itself requires replacement. However, if the motor is completely silent, check for voltage at its terminals using a multimeter. The lack of voltage with a working thermostat will indicate a break in the wiring or a problem with the control board, if it is present in your modification.
Problems of the No Frost system in the refrigerator compartment
If your Stinol is equipped with a system No Frostthen there is no cold in the upper compartment when the freezer is running often indicates a violation of air circulation. Cold is generated in the freezer and is forced by a fan into the refrigerator compartment through special channels. If these channels are clogged with ice or snow, the air simply does not reach the products.
The cause of the formation of an ice plug in the air ducts is most often a malfunction of the defrost system. This could be a burnt-out evaporator heating element, a faulty defrost timer or a defrost sensor. As a result, the evaporator becomes overgrown with a “fur coat” that blocks the air flow. This can be seen visually if you remove the back plastic panel inside the freezer (where the ice usually lies).
- ❄️ Ice on the back wall of the freezer is a sure sign that the defrosting system is not working.
- 🌬️ Lack of air flow from the holes in the refrigerator compartment when operating fan.
- 🔊 The fan may hum or crackle if its blades touch frozen ice.
To temporarily solve the problem, you can completely defrost the refrigerator. Unplug the appliance, open the doors and leave it for at least 24 hours (preferably two days). This will allow the ice in the hidden channels to completely melt. If after switching on the cold appears, but after a week or two it disappears again, the elements of the defrosting system need to be replaced.
Malfunctions of the thermostat and temperature sensors
The thermostat (thermostat) is the “brain” that decides when to turn the compressor on and off. In mechanically controlled refrigerators, the thermostat is a device with a capillary tube that is attached to the evaporator. If this tube has shifted, oxidized, or the mechanism itself has failed, the refrigerator compressor may not start at all. In electronically controlled models, temperature sensors (thermistors) perform the role of a thermostat. Their resistance varies depending on the temperature of the environment. If the sensor “lies” and shows the control module that it is -10°C in the chamber, although in fact it is +15°C, the refrigerator will not cool. The sensors are checked with a multimeter in resistance measurement mode.
A frequent problem is oxidation of the contacts in the sensor connectors due to high humidity. Remove the plastic trim in the refrigerator compartment, locate the sensor (usually located closer to the ceiling of the refrigerator or on the back wall) and check the integrity of the wiring. Sometimes it is enough just to clean the contacts for the device to work.
Clogged capillary tube and freon leak
One of the most unpleasant reasons why the freezer works, but the refrigerator does not, is a partial blockage of the capillary tube or a micro-leak of refrigerant. Unlike a complete leak, in which no chamber works, with a partial loss of freon or blockage, the pressure in the system drops, and the refrigerant has time to freeze only in the primary circuit (freezer), without reaching the evaporator of the refrigeration chamber.
It is difficult to diagnose a leak or blockage at home, but there are indirect signs. Pay attention to the condenser (the grill on the back of the refrigerator). If it is only partially hot or, conversely, cold everywhere except the area near the compressor, this is a bad sign. Also, the problem is indicated by a too hot compressor housing, which works non-stop, trying to gain temperature.
| Symptom | Probable cause | Check method |
|---|---|---|
| The compressor runs constantly | Freon leak or blockage | Checking the pressure with a pressure gauge |
| The evaporator is covered with uneven ice | Lack of freon | Visual inspection after removing the panel |
| The refrigerator turns on rarely | Thermostat is faulty | Thermostat contacts are checked |
| A gurgling sound is heard | Leakage or air in the system | Audio diagnostics during operation |
To eliminate a leak or blockage, you need to call a technician with a vacuum pump and equipment for refilling freon. It is impossible to add gas or clean the system without special tools. Stinol Often uses refrigerant R600a (isobutane), which is a fire hazard, so working with it requires strict adherence to safety precautions.
Why can’t you just add freon?
Adding freon without eliminating the cause of the leak is temporary measure. In addition, there may be moisture in the system, which, when mixed with oil and freon, forms an acid that kills the compressor within a few months.
Failure of the electronic control module
Modern models Stinol (especially series 205, 256 and higher) are controlled by an electronic module. If the control board is malfunctioning, it may not supply voltage to the solenoid (valve) that opens the supply of freon to the refrigeration chamber circuit, or may not turn on the fan. At the same time, the freezer continues to operate in normal mode, since its circuit can be independent or priority.
Signs of a module malfunction: chaotic blinking of indicators on the panel, spontaneous turning on and off of the compressor, lack of response to changes in temperature settings. Sometimes a module fails due to a power surge. Visually, you can see blackened traces, swollen capacitors, or traces of burning on the board.
Module repair requires soldering skills and knowledge of electronics. It is often cheaper and more reliable to replace the entire board with a similar one or reflash the existing one, if such a possibility is provided by the manufacturer. However, before you sin on the electronics, make sure that all actuators (heating elements, sensors) are in good working order, since the module could burn out precisely because of a short circuit in one of them.

Mechanical damage and door seals
Don’t forget about simple things. If the refrigerator door does not close tightly, warm, moist air constantly enters. The cooling system cannot cope with the heat influx, and the temperature rises. In a freezer that is visited less often and kept closed, the cold is retained better, creating the illusion that the lower part is in good working order.
Check the rubber seal around the perimeter of the door. On Stinol he becomes tanned over time, cracks or moves away from the body. Do a test with a sheet of paper: clamp the sheet with a door around the perimeter. If it is pulled out without force, the seal is broken. Also check the hinges: if the door is skewed and does not fit tightly, no technique will help until you adjust the awnings.
⚠️ Attention: If the seal is simply dirty, wipe it with soapy water. If it is deformed, try softening it with a hairdryer and straightening it, but if there are cracks, only replacement will help.
Frequently opening the door or placing hot foods in the chamber can also cause a temporary temperature failure. In this case, the compressor will wear out, but will eventually restore the temperature if the system is working properly. Give the refrigerator time to enter mode without loading food.
Frequently asked questions about Stinol repair (FAQ)
Is it possible to operate the refrigerator if one chamber does not work?
Technically start the device it is possible, but this will lead to overload of the compressor and its rapid failure. In addition, food in a warm chamber will spoil. It is better to turn off the device before repair.
How much does it cost to replace a compressor with Stinol?
The cost consists of the price of the unit itself, soldering, vacuuming and refilling with freon. On average, this is about 60-70% of the cost of a new budget refrigerator, which often makes repairs economically unfeasible.
Why did the refrigerator work after defrosting, but after 3 days it stopped again?
This is a classic symptom of a malfunction of the defrost system (No Frost). The ice melted, the channels became free, and the cold began to set in. But since the heating element or timer is not working, ice has accumulated again and blocked the channels. Replacement of defrosting elements is required.
